About Paphos Airport Bus Connections
Paphos International Airport (PFO) serves the west of the island and is connected by bus to Paphos town and the tourist area of Kato Paphos around the harbour and castle. Airport buses also run along the coast to Limassol, making them a practical link for travellers heading east. The service is operated as part of the wider Paphos urban and intercity network, and the stop sits just outside the compact terminal, so it is an easy walk with luggage.
How Often Airport Buses Run
Buses from Paphos Airport are timetabled rather than turn-up-and-go, and gaps between services can be long, especially in the evening — this is the route where checking times in advance saves the most hassle. Tips for the Paphos Airport Bus
- 1The stop is a short walk from the terminal exit; signage points the way.
- 2For the harbour and most hotels, you want Kato Paphos rather than the upper town (Ktima).
- 3Evening flights can land after the last convenient bus — confirm the timetable before relying on it.
- 4Heading to Limassol? The coastal coach from Paphos is the cheapest option.
